Complete Guide to GNU/Linux: Start Your Journey with the Free Operating System
Introduction
Are you ready to explore the world of GNU/Linux? Whether you’re a beginner or switching from Windows or macOS, this complete guide will help you start your journey with the free operating system. Linux is a powerful, open-source alternative that gives you full control over your computer. In this guide, we’ll cover everything from choosing a Linux distribution to mastering essential Linux commands.
π Linux Quick-Start Guide β Learn the basics and get started fast!

-
1. What is GNU/Linux?
GNU/Linux is an open-source operating system built on the Linux kernel. Unlike Windows or macOS, Linux is free to use, modify, and distribute. It’s widely used for servers, development, and even desktop computing.
Key Features of Linux:
- β Free and open-source
- β Highly customizable
- β More secure than proprietary systems
- β Lightweight and fast
-
2. Why Choose Linux Over Windows and macOS?
Many users switch to Linux for its freedom, security, and flexibility. Hereβs why Linux is a great alternative:
- πΉ Free to Use β No licensing fees or restrictions
- πΉ More Secure β Less vulnerable to malware and viruses
- πΉ Customizable β Choose from various desktop environments (GNOME, KDE, XFCE)
- πΉ Lightweight β Runs smoothly even on old hardware
-
3. Best Linux Distros for Beginners
Choosing the right Linux distribution (distro) is the first step in your Linux journey. Below are the best beginner-friendly options:
- π’ Ubuntu β The most popular Linux distro, great for beginners.
- π΅ Linux Mint β A Windows-like experience with a smooth transition.
- π‘ Fedora β Cutting-edge technology with an easy interface.
Each of these distributions offers a user-friendly experience and a strong community for support. Click the links above to follow the step-by-step setup guides!
-
4. How to Install Linux: A Step-by-Step Guide
Want to install Linux? Follow these steps:
π Step-by-Step Linux Installation Guide β Follow a complete tutorial!
Step 1: Download a Linux Distro
Visit the official website of your chosen distro (e.g., ubuntu.com, linuxmint.com).
Step 2: Create a Bootable USB
Use software like Rufus (Windows) or balenaEtcher (Mac & Linux) to create a bootable USB drive.
Step 3: Boot from USB
Restart your computer, enter the BIOS, and select the USB as the boot device.
Step 4: Install Linux
Follow the installation wizard to set up your new Linux system.
-
5. Linux Command Line Basics
The Linux Terminal is powerful and essential for advanced users. Here are a few basic commands:
π Linux Command Line Basics β Master essential commands!
- π
ls
β List files in a directory - π
cd
β Change directory - π
mkdir
β Create a new folder - π
rm
β Delete a file or folder - π
sudo
β Run commands with admin privileges
Mastering these commands will make using Linux even more efficient!
- π
-
6. Getting Started with Linux Software
Linux supports thousands of free applications. Some must-have software includes:
π Best Software for Linux β Discover top applications!
- β LibreOffice β Free alternative to Microsoft Office
- β GIMP β Open-source Photoshop alternative
- β VLC Media Player β Plays all media formats
- β Firefox & Chromium β Secure and fast web browsers
Conclusion
Congratulations! Youβve taken the first steps to start your journey with the free operating system. With the knowledge from this complete guide to GNU/Linux, you’re now ready to install Linux, explore different distros, and dive into the world of open-source computing.
πΉ Whatβs next? Try using Linux daily and experiment with customization!